摘要
We extend to a new antiferromagnetic alloy, IrMn, point-contact based studies of the effect of a large current density on the exchange bias at antiferromagnet/ferromagnet (AFM/F) interfaces. Similarly to the case of AFM=CoFe, a negative current density similar to 10(12) A/m(2) injected through the F=CoFe into an IrMn/CoFe interface was found to increase the exchange bias, while a positive current decreased it. The model used to describe the data for FeMn/CoFe, based on predicted current-induced torques on AFM, can explain the new data. (C) 2009 American Institute of Physics. [DOI: 10.1063/1.3057951]
